【文件属性】:
文件名称:smooth-corners:带有Houdini APICSS超椭圆形蒙版
文件大小:149KB
文件格式:ZIP
更新时间:2021-04-29 23:54:11
css diamond square circle curve
光滑的角落
使用 API的超级椭圆蒙版
演示版
具有几个不同的- --smooth-corners值和一个交互式编辑器
用法
CSS
将mask-image: paint(smooth-corners)到要蒙版的元素上
默认(Squircle)
. squircle {
mask-image : paint (smooth-corners);
-webkit-mask-image : paint (smooth-corners);
background : # d01257 ; /* So you can see it */
}
自定义曲率
您可以使用CSS变量来自定义蒙版曲率。 这可以在选择器本地范围内定义,也可以在:root {}全局定义
--smooth-corners: X[, Y]
X-浮动,X轴的曲率
Y-浮动,Y轴的曲率(可选,默认为X轴)
X值形状
0
【文件预览】:
smooth-corners-master
----paint.js(2KB)
----package.json(984B)
----.github()
--------images()
--------workflows()
----sandbox.config.json(27B)
----index.html(18KB)
----LICENSE(1KB)
----.npmignore(84B)
----.gitignore(17B)
----.browserslistrc(25B)
----README.md(4KB)
----yarn.lock(163KB)
----.mdlrc(35B)